Regular Inspection and Pumping

Usually, a residential septic tank needs to be professionally examined on a regular basis, typically every 3 to 5 years by experienced technicians. During this inspection, the professional examiners can check for leaks, check both the upper and lower sections of your tank, analyze the accumulated scum and sludge in your sewage tank, and execute skilled pumping of your tank.

Efficient Use Of Water

The lower the amount of water in a residence equates to reduced water going into the sewage system. Toilet flushing habits accounts for approximately 25-30% of water consumption in the residential property. The most effective approach to reduce water usage in the toilet involves replacing older models with low-flow fixtures, employing fewer gallons of water for each flushing.

High Efficiency Shower Heads

Water used when showering additionally sent to the sewage system. To decrease this, the smart choice is to utilize low-flow shower heads, specifically designed to decrease water consumption.

Proper Disposal of Waste

Many people exhibit the unfortunate habit of dealing with the bathroom as if it were a trash can. However, practicing this behavior inevitably septic system clogs. Therefore, householders should make sure that everyone in the household disposes of waste appropriately and doesn't flush it down the toilet.

Seasonal Septic System Care Advice

As crucial as maintaining the sewage system each year, seasonal care is just as important to provide season-specific care and maintenance to the sewage tank system. Below are several tips for year-round care and maintenance for the seasonal changes:

Fall (Autumn)

Ensuring proper maintenance of the sewage system is crucial in anticipating for the harsh winter weather.

  • Consider pumping the septic tank before winter arrives, as it's hard when winter sets in.
  • During the fall season, restrict the use of grass cutters in the area near the septic tank, and avoid using vehicles in this area at all costs.
  • Additionally, take measures to shield the treatment area from cold temperatures.
Winter

Caring for septic systems during the winter might be significant challenges, given the freezing temperatures. Hence, it's advisable to start preparing for cold weather in advance, preferably in the fall.

The crucial attention you can provide for your septic tank system in winter involves regularly inspecting the four common areas where septic systems might freeze, with the goal of avoiding this problem. These areas include:

  • The pipeline emanating from the house's tank
  • The piping leading to the area designated for soil treatment
  • The designated soil treatment zone
  • And the waste tank
Spring
  • Taking care of your septic system during spring involves the following steps:
  • As the sun begins to shine and the snow starts melting, it's the perfect time to plan a expert inspection of your septic tank. This assessment ensures the health of your septic tank.
  • Springtime offers an excellent opportunity to replace your septic tank filter. The filter may be obstructed during the winter months, potentially causing septic system issues.
  • Spring is an opportune moment to plan a tank maintenance. This helps ensure optimal performance of your septic tank.
Summer

Summer septic system care involves the following steps:

  • Warm weather in the summer can heighten the septic tank odors, so homeowners should be prepared to seek professional septic tank services in the summer months.
  • Water usage tends to increase in the summer, causing more water entering the septic tank. To mitigate this, switch to high-efficiency toilets that are more water-efficient.

Types Of Septic Tank Systems Available

During the process of installing a septic tank, experts take multiple factors into account, including which include the scale of the property, weather patterns, environmental factors of the area, nature of the soil, and so forth.

All of these aspects influence in determining the appropriate variety of septic tank system to be. Below are numerous varieties of septic tank systems available for installation at DJ Plumbing Septic Tank Services:

Conventional Tank System

Commonly described as a gravity-based sewage system, this kind of septic system is both the most prevalent and the most straightforward to install and maintain. This particular septic tank system doesn't demand any extra complex electrical or technological elements. Instead, it relies exclusively on natural forces, specifically gravity.

Chamber Septic Tank System

Commonly known as the pressure distribution septic system, utilizes drain chambers usually crafted from plastic, specifically high-density polyethylene. However,, it's worth noting that other materials can also be used for these chambers.

Over the past three decades, this variety of septic tank system has gained considerable recognition, primarily due to its cost-effectiveness and ease of installation. Caring for it follows a similar process to that of a standard septic tank system.

Mound Septic Tank System

This particular septic tank system is employed for properties positioned on thin soil or adjacent to surface bedrock. The installation of this tank system involves creating a man-made mound consisting of distinct layers of soil, gravel, and sand as the drainfield.

As opposed to the traditional septic tank system, this particular septic tank system utilizes electrical energy, as well as demands periodic maintenance and examinations, in contrast to the typical septic tank system, which is considerably easier to maintain.

Aerobic Treatment Unit

Referred to as ATU or Aerobic Treatment Unit, this type of septic tank system makes use of an electric pump for pumping oxygen into the septic tank. The addition of oxygen allows aerobic microbes to flourish within the septic tank. This process causes the biodegradation of waste materials contained within the septic tank.

Typically, this type of septic tank is usually built in locations near surface aquatic environments or in areas with hostile soil characteristics. It should be emphasized that maintaining this type of septic tank system comes with a high cost, because it demands ongoing maintenance treatments.

Recirculating Sand Filter Septic Tank System

This particular septic tank system makes use of sand filtration to process and redistribute of wastewater. To work efficiently, this system requires the use of electricity. As opposed to other types of sewage tanks, the setup and ongoing care of such a system tends to be relatively expensive.

Canfield is a city in central Mahoning County, Ohio, United States. The population was 7,699 as of the 2020 census. A suburb about 8 miles (13 km) southwest of Youngstown, the city lies at the intersection of U.S. Routes 62 and 224 and is part of the Youngstown–Warren metropolitan area. In 2005, Canfield was rated the 82nd best place to live in the United States by Money magazine.
